Artwork by Gary Grimshaw, presented by The Council for the Summer of Love, image depicts two winged women flying over the San Francisco skyline with text below listing performers on the bill that day including Jefferson Starship, Country Joe McDonald, Ken Kesey & The Merry Pranksters, and Ray Manzarek, among many others; Helms' signature in black felt-tip ink appears in the center; further signed and numbered in black felt-tip ink "Gary Grimshaw 428/515." Also included are Welnick's two backstage passes to this "Summer of Love" event plus two programs, one postcard, and a four-page fax sent to Welnick regarding the "Chet Helms Tribal Stomp" that took place on October 30, 2005, which honored the beloved music promoter and Bay Area legend who had died that year. 19 x 13in
